
Can-Am League Recap
Published on July 14, 2010 under Canadian American League (Can-Am) News Release
Worcester 3, Quebec 2 (Game 1 - 7 Innings)
1B Chris Colabello's solo home run in the sixth inning broke a 2-2 tie and lifted the Worcester Tornadoes past the Quebec Capitales, 3-2 in game one of the doubleheader. Worcester reliever Albert Ayala notched his second win of the season as he tossed two scoreless innings allowing only a walk. For Quebec in defeat, SS Josh Colafemina and DH Jeremy Hunt each had two-hit games, accounting for four of their five hits.
Worcester 3, Quebec 1 (Game 2 - 7 Innings)
The Worcester Tornadoes completed the doubleheader sweep as the Tornadoes beat the Quebec Capitales 3-1 in game two. 1B Nick Salotti led the Tornadoes offense going 1-for-2 and scoring two runs. The Worcester pitching was excellent as the trio of John Kelly, Shawn Gilblair and Eric Asadoorian combined to allow only a run on two hits with seven strikeouts.
Sussex at New Jersey (Cancelled - Rain)
The game scheduled between Sussex and New Jersey was cancelled due to rain. Since the two teams do not meet again in the first half, the game will not be made up.
